Day 2: Istanbul City Tour (B)
Breakfast at hotel and begin full
day sightseeing tour of Istanbul. We’ll visit Topkapi
Palace (harem section is optional), ancient Roman
Hippodrome (center of the chariot races), the
magnificent Blue Mosque, Hagia Sophia, the Byzantine
church which was converted to a mosque in 15th century
and we will stop at Grand Covered Bazaar and will have
free time to discover 4000 tiny shops in the passageways
of the world’s largest covered bazaar. Overnight: Istanbul

After breakfast we will proceed to
Aspendos, another city in Pamphylia, known for having
the best-preserved theater of antiquity, still used
today for concerts, festivals and grease wrestling
events. Then we will depart to Konya, city where Mevlana Rumi is buried,
founder of the most well-known Sufi order, Mevleviye.
They are also known as the “Whirling Dervishes” due to
their famous practice of whirling ceremony called Sema
which represents a spiritual journey through mind and
love to "Perfect”.
Finally
we’ll arrive to the “moon-like“landscape of
Cappadocia.Optional: Whirling Dervishes
performance in a 13th century Caravan inn.
Overnight: Cappadocia
